Omar Abdullah bites the dust in Lok Sabha Elections 2024; Sheikh Abdul Rashid emerges victorious 

Omar Abdullah has accepted defeat from the Baramula Lok Sabha Constituency in the recentky concluded 2024 elections. Abdullah conceded defeat to the independent Sheikh Abdul Rashid (aka Engineer Rashid) by a 167731 votes as per ECI report

Omar Abdullah lost to former MLA Sheikh Abdul Rashid after he was challenged in a three-cornered battle as the jailed leader and former MLA, Rashid (aka Engineer Rashid) challenged him along with Sajjad Gani Lone in the battle for The Baramulla Lok Sabha seat from North Kashmir. Abdullah lost by 184520 votes as per the ECI.

The Baramulla Lok Sabha constituency influences the electoral equations for 15 assembly segments, namely, Karnah, Langate, Uri, Baramula, Gulmarg, Kupwara, Lolab, Rafiabad, Sopore, Gurez, Bandipur, Sonawari, Sangrama, Handwara, and Pattan.

The Baramulla Lok Sabha Constituency, went to polls on May 20, 2024 and was won by Mohammad Akbar Lone from JKN in the run-up to Lok Sabha of 2019 with a winning margin of 6.64 per cent .

The Baramulla Lok Sabha constituency houses an electorate of 17.2 lakh. Omar Abdullah has served as the Minister of State for External Affairs in the Vajpayee Government (July 2001-December 2002).

Omar has also served as the Chief Minister of Jammu & Kashmir from  January 2009 to Jan 2015 after he stitched an alliance with the Indian National Congress.

Omar Abdullah has been vice president of the Jammu Kashmir National Conference since 2009 after he inherited the National Conference from the illustrious Faruq Abdullah Family.
